WebMegabit is always expressed with a lowercase "b," and megabyte is always expressed with an uppercase "B." A byte is 8 bits. One megabyte per second is equal to 8 megabits per second. To get Mbps from MBps, multiply by eight. To see MBps, take the Mbps, and divide by eight or multiply by 0.125. WebISPs and speed testing sites measure speed in Mbps (megabits per second). Downloads in game clients and web browsers are measured in MBps (megabytes per second). There are 8 bits in 1 byte. Take server overhead into account and 30 MBps is about right for a 300 Mbps connection.
